Transaction 306076eead966d2baa6ebde24dc6892ecc48b421c6f6795f4e78c6b3ad884fe4
1 Input
1 Output
-
306076eead966d2baa6ebde24dc6892ecc48b421c6f6795f4e78c6b3ad884fe4:0
- value
- 99935760
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 80056378a650c67655f7207419a0d02aad2b2647 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CfuwxZfh5Gx5z5zYsEm99nnwPPxoftqHD